Iranian Central Bank – Crypto Rules, VPN Risks & Exchange Updates

When working with Iranian Central Bank, the official monetary authority of Iran that oversees banking, currency policy, and cryptocurrency regulation. Also known as CBI, it sets the legal framework that dictates which digital assets can be traded, how exchanges operate, and what penalties apply for non‑compliance.

One of the key cryptocurrency regulation, rules that define how crypto businesses must register, report, and manage user data in Iran directly drives the crypto exchange restrictions, limits imposed on platforms like Nobitex, including licensing requirements and transaction caps. The Iranian Central Bank also influences VPN usage, the practice of routing internet traffic through encrypted tunnels to bypass local blocks because authorities monitor VPN traffic to enforce compliance. When the Nobitex hack, the 2024 security breach on Iran's leading crypto exchange that exposed user funds occurred, the Central Bank tightened its oversight, demanding higher security standards and introducing new taxes on stablecoin transactions.

These dynamics create a chain of cause and effect: the Central Bank enforces stricter cryptocurrency regulation, which expands exchange restrictions; tighter exchange rules push traders toward VPN usage, raising detection risks; and high‑profile incidents like the Nobitex hack trigger further regulatory adjustments. For anyone navigating Iran's crypto scene, understanding each link helps you stay compliant, protect assets, and avoid costly penalties.
